Rep. Gwen Moore Questions Sec. Bessent on Medicaid, SNAP, and Medicare Cuts

4 connectionsΒ·7 entities in this videoβQuestioning Budgetary Cuts
- π― Rep. Gwen Moore questioned Secretary Scott Bessent regarding proposed cuts to Medicaid, SNAP, and Medicare as part of the "Big Beautiful Bill."
- π‘ Moore challenged the characterization of these cuts as solely addressing "waste, fraud, and abuse," listing specific amounts for ACA subsidies, Medicaid, SNAP, and Medicare.
The Tyranny of Averages
- π Moore highlighted the issue of using averages to describe tax impacts, citing the example of one taxpayer receiving a million-dollar refund versus another receiving $1, leading to an average of $500,50.
- π This method, she argued, masks significant distributional inequalities and skewed outcomes, particularly for individuals earning under $50,000.
Tax Cuts and Spending
- π° The discussion touched upon whether tax cuts should be considered spending, especially concerning their impact on the national debt and interest rates.
- β οΈ Moore pressed Bessent on whether a tax gap of $700 billion annually due to wealthy individuals evading taxes constitutes "waste, fraud, and abuse."
IRS Budget and Financial Insecurity
- βοΈ Moore pointed out a 31% budget cut to the IRS, including a significant reduction in IT modernization, which she argued would hinder the collection of taxes.
- β οΈ She questioned whether individuals experiencing financial insecurity (50% of Americans) would suffer from cuts to Medicaid, SNAP, and ACA.
Bill Design and Expiration of Benefits
- β Moore questioned why benefits within the bill, such as the senior tax credit and no tax on tips, are designed to expire if the intention is to uplift families.
- π€ She invited the Secretary to join in making these benefits permanent, but the time for discussion expired.
